What Does Witch Hazel Do for Cats?

What Does Witch Hazel Do for Cats

Witch hazel possesses natural anti-inflammatory and astringent properties, making it a potential solution for various skin issues in cats. When used properly, it can help alleviate mild discomfort and irritation.


Can I Use Witch Hazel on My Cat for Itching?

Can I Use Witch Hazel on My Cat for Itching

Yes, witch hazel can be used on cats for itching caused by minor skin irritations. However, it’s crucial to dilute it properly and avoid applying it on open wounds or sensitive areas.


Here are some more points to consider when using witch hazel for your Cat:

  1. Cooling Effect: Witch hazel can provide a cooling sensation on the skin, which may offer additional relief for your Cat if they are experiencing discomfort from itching or irritation.
  2. Reduces Swelling: Its anti-inflammatory properties can help reduce swelling in areas where your Cat may have minor skin issues.
  3. Gentle Alternative: It can be a gentle alternative to some commercial pet products that may contain harsh chemicals.
  4. Accessible and Affordable: Witch hazel is readily available in most drugstores and is generally affordable, making it a convenient option for pet owners.
  5. Supports Healing: Witch hazel can support the natural healing process of minor skin irritations.
  6. Mild Antimicrobial Properties: Witch hazel has mild antimicrobial effects that can help cleanse the skin and potentially prevent secondary infections from developing.
  7. Non-Greasy and Non-Sticky: Witch hazel is a lightweight solution that doesn’t leave a greasy or sticky residue on your Cat’s fur or skin.
  8. Eases Discomfort from Bug Bites: If insects have bitten your Cat, witch hazel may help reduce the itching and discomfort associated with the bites.

Can You Clean a Cat’s Ear with Witch Hazel?

Can You Clean a Cat's Ear

Yes, you can clean a cat’s ear with witch hazel, but it must be done with great care and under the guidance of a veterinarian. While witch hazel is sometimes used in ear-cleaning solutions, it’s best to rely on vet-approved products or recipes. 


Here are some important points to consider:

  1. Dilution is Key: If your vet approves the use of witch hazel for ear cleaning, make sure to dilute it properly. Mix it with equal water to create a safe and gentle solution.
  2. Do Not Overclean: Cleaning your Cat’s ears should be done as needed and as your veterinarian recommends. Overcleaning can disrupt the natural balance of the ear and potentially lead to further issues.
  3. Monitor for Any Changes: After cleaning your Cat’s ears, watch for any signs of redness, swelling, discharge, or unusual odor. If you notice any of these, contact your vet promptly.
  4. Observe Your Cat’s Reaction: Pay attention to your Cat’s behavior during and after cleaning. If they show discomfort or irritation, stop immediately and consult your vet.
  5. Avoid Q-Tips or Cotton Swabs: Do not use Q-tips or cotton swabs to clean the inside of your Cat’s ears. These can cause waste further into the ear canal and potentially cause injury.
  6. Use a Gentle Application Method: Apply the diluted witch hazel solution using a soft, clean cloth or a cotton ball. Gently wipe the interior of your Cat’s ears, careful not to go too in-depth.
  7. Seek Professional Help for Ear Issues: If your Cat is experiencing ear problems such as infection, excessive wax buildup, or any signs of discomfort, it’s crucial to consult a vet for proper diagnosis and treatment.

Is Witch Hazel Toxic to Cats?

Is Witch Hazel Toxic to Cats?

Witch hazel is generally considered safe for cats when used appropriately and in moderation. However, it’s important to use a pure, alcohol-free formulation and to always consult a vet before using it on your Cat.


However, there are a few important points to keep in mind:

  1. Dilution: Witch hazel should always be diluted with water before applying it to your Cat. Using it in its undiluted form can be too strong and potentially irritating to their skin.
  2. Alcohol Content: Some commercial witch hazel products may contain a small amount of alcohol, which can irritate a cat’s skin. It’s best to use an alcohol-free witch hazel solution when applying it to your Cat.
  3. Avoid Sensitive Areas: Be cautious around sensitive areas such as the eyes, ears, and nose. Applying a substance directly into a cat’s ears with veterinary guidance is generally only recommended.
  4. Consult a Veterinarian: Before using witch hazel or any other substance on your Cat, especially for medical purposes, it’s always best to consult a veterinarian. They can provide clear guidance based on your Cat’s health and existing essentials.
  5. Monitor for Reactions: Even when properly diluted, it’s a good practice to monitor your Cat for any signs of irritation or adverse reactions after using witch hazel.
